SHARK TANK - EPISODE 404
ENTREPRENEUR: David & Nique Mealy
PITCH: Back 9 Dips
ASKING FOR: $150k for a 15% stake
BEST PART OF THE PITCH: David and Nique have created a brand of buffalo chicken dips created with all white meat chicken breasts along with wing and dipping sauces. They blend it all together so you can get everything you get on a chicken wing on a chip. Daymond calls their dips a "Chicken Slurpee." Kevin can't stop cracking up at the thought of these two sticking a chicken in a blender. Tears of laughter stream from his face. David and Nique have a little less than $400,000 in sales in less than two years. They have a deal with a supermarket chain in Florida where their product is selling well.
DO THE SHARKS BITE? Lori loves the taste of the product. She also thinks David and Nique are great, but she's not the right person to help them get their products into supermarkets. She's out. Mark thinks they are going to do wonderful things, but he also goes out because this is not his thing. Kevin admires their stick-to-itiveness to survive, but the risk is just too much for him. He's out. Robert thinks this a brutal business and he's not the right partner for them. That leaves only Daymond. Or does it?
THE RESULT Lori really likes this couple. She offers to come back in and partner with Daymond for a 25% stake. Daymond recalls a time when he was in a similar situation as these two folks. They have one child with another one on the way. Still, Daymond can't bring himself to invest. Lori is out there alone, but not for long. Robert believes these two deserve a shot. He partners with Lori and the deal is done. More tears flow in the tank. The difference is that this time they are tears of joy. Daymond also offers to help from afar.
